Chapter 1: Arjuna's Dilemmaअर्जुनविषादयोग

1:16

King Yudhishthira, the son of Kunti, blew his conchshell Anantavijaya, and Nakula and Sahadeva blew the Sughosha and Manipushpaka.

Sanskrit

अनन्तविजयं राजा कुन्तीपुत्रो युधिष्ठिरः | नकुलः सहदेवश्च सुघोषमणिपुष्पकौ ||

Transliteration

anantavijayaṁ rājā kuntī-putro yudhiṣṭhiraḥ nakulaḥ sahadevaś ca sughoṣa-maṇipuṣpakau

Commentary

Yudhishthira's conchshell Anantavijaya means 'endless victory,' reflecting his righteous claim. The twins' conchshells add their voices to the Pandava response.
